Use of Other FCC Registered Equipment
Aside from the Ringer Equivalence reporting as explained above, use of other FCC
equipment may provide for specific limitations depending upon the type of
equipment. Check the instructions included with such equipment to determine what
the limitations are, if any, on the use of such equipment.

Automatic Dialers
The Iwatsu Enterprise-CS contains features that provide for the automatic dialing of
outgoing calls. When programming Emergency Numbers and/or making test calls to
Emergency Numbers:
Remain on the line and briefly explain to the dispatcher the reason for the
call.
Perform such activities during off-peak hours such as early morning or late
evening.

Toll Restriction and Optimized Routing Features
The Iwatsu Enterprise-CS provides both Toll Restriction and Optimized Routing
features that may be programmed in your system. The software or programming
contained in the Iwatsu Enterprise-CS may be required to be upgraded to allow user
access to the network in order to recognize newly established network area codes and
exchange codes as they are placed in service. Failure to upgrade the programming or
software (if required) to recognize the new codes as they are established will restrict
the user from gaining access to the network and to these codes.

Direct-Inward-Dialing (DID) Requirements
The Iwatsu Enterprise-CS meets all FCC requirements for Direct-Inward-Dialing
(DID) service by providing Answer Supervision on incoming DID calls in
accordance with FCC regulations. Allowing this equipment to be operated in such a
manner as to not provide proper Answer Supervision is a violation of Part 68 of the
FCC's rules. The equipment returns proper Answer Supervision to the local telephone
exchange when DID calls are: answered by the called station, answered by the
attendant, routed to a recorded announcement that can be administered by the system
user, routed to a dial prompt (instruction).
